Re: Info on a Gale Buccaneer 5hp

5D22B is a 63 the last year for Gale production.It shares many components with the similar Evinrude/Johnson motors. Fuel mix is 24:1 using TCW3rated oil.Routine parts are still available
under the E/J applications.There are parts and reprint factory parts and service manuals here at iboats. Also many BRP dealers and dozens of venders of routine and more obscure parts.
